Crushing Caliche: The Bedrock of Rural Roads
Caliche commonly litters the landscape, a solid and enduring presence that's vital to rural roads. This hardened layer of calcium carbonate, formed gradually, forms the foundation upon which countless miles of gravel roads are built. The process of grinding caliche into a fine substance is difficult, but essential for creating durable and long-lasting routes.
Crushing caliche isn't just a matter of breaking up rocks.
It requires precise tools to achieve the right texture for a stable road surface. The fineness of the crushed caliche determines its ability to bind, ultimately dictating click here the durability of the road.
- Rural roads often rely heavily on caliche, as it's a readily available resource in many areas.
Caliche Crust: Taming the Wild Terrain
In arid regions where the relentless sun beats down and rainfall is scarce, a unique phenomenon emerges: caliche crust. This hardened layer of calcium carbonate emerges across the ground, presenting both challenges and opportunities for those who work with it. Its impenetrable nature can hinder root development, making cultivation a difficult task. Yet, this very strength also offers protection to the delicate ecosystem beneath.
Taming the wild terrain of caliche crust requires innovative strategies. From careful soil management techniques to specialized agricultural practices, humans have learned to adjust their methods to survive in these challenging environments. Understanding the formation and properties of caliche is crucial for enhancing land use and promoting sustainable development in arid regions.
